On Apr 09, Manoj Srivastava <srivasta@datasync.com> wrote:
> Those files are small. One can copy them back easily (using
> ftp, even), sign them locally, and upload two tiny files.
That's not enough. After I signed the .changes and .dsc files (and moved
back the other files from REJECT/) I received that from dinstall:
Rejected: md5sum failed
md5sum: MD5 check failed for 'binkd_0.9.2-3.dsc'
Looks like I have to sign the .dsc, generate the new md5 hash with md5sum,
manually edit the .changes file and sign it.
